Writing is a way to communicate information and ideas. Usually people decide to write in order to inform, persuade a reader to agree with their opinion, or give a story on their experiences. Before writing, it is wise to think about why you are writing and how to communicate your ideas most effectively to the reader. Writers should determine their purpose for writing, tailor their work so it fits for a certain audience, choose a specific mode, and decide which genres they want to employ in their writing.
